Wind erosion has largely shaped the American Southwest because of its desert climate. Water would normally play an equal role in erosion, but the sand is very loose because of the lack of rain.

Mars has a variety of landforms including mountains, valleys, canyons, plains, and polar ice caps. Some notable features include Olympus Mons, the largest volcano in the solar system, and Valles Marineris, a vast canyon system. Overall, there are many diverse and fascinating landforms on Mars shaped by its unique geologic history.

Wind erosion has shaped many landforms in the American Southwest due to the region's dry, arid climate and the prevalence of loose, erodible sedimentary rock formations like sandstone. Over time, wind can pick up and transport these particles, wearing away at the landscape to create distinctive features such as mesas, buttes, and sand dunes.
Wind erosion has shaped many landforms in the American Southwest due to the region's arid climate and sparse vegetation, which leave the land exposed to strong winds. Over time, these winds pick up loose sediment and carry it across the landscape, sculpting unique features like mesas, arches, and hoodoos. The process is further intensified by the presence of soft sedimentary rocks that are easily eroded by wind.
